在 CentOS 系統中,如果你遇到掛載權限不足的問題,可以嘗試以下方法解決:
使用 sudo
命令提升權限:
在掛載命令前加上 sudo
,以管理員權限執行掛載操作。例如:
sudo mount /dev/sdb1 /mnt/mydisk
檢查 /etc/fstab
文件:
如果你想在系統啟動時自動掛載設備,請檢查 /etc/fstab
文件。確保你有足夠的權限編輯此文件,通常需要管理員權限。使用以下命令編輯 /etc/fstab
文件:
sudo vi /etc/fstab
在文件中添加正確的掛載條目,然后保存并退出。例如:
/dev/sdb1 /mnt/mydisk ext4 defaults 0 0
檢查設備所有權和權限:
使用 lsblk
或 blkid
命令查看設備的所有權和權限。例如:
lsblk
或
sudo blkid
如果設備所有權或權限不正確,可以使用 chown
和 chmod
命令更改它們。例如:
sudo chown your_username:your_group /dev/sdb1
sudo chmod 660 /dev/sdb1
檢查 SELinux 設置:
如果你的系統啟用了 SELinux,可能需要調整相關策略以允許掛載操作??梢允褂?getenforce
命令查看 SELinux 的狀態:
getenforce
如果需要臨時禁用 SELinux,可以使用以下命令:
sudo setenforce 0
要永久禁用 SELinux,請編輯 /etc/selinux/config
文件,將 SELINUX=enforcing
更改為 SELINUX=disabled
,然后重啟系統。
嘗試以上方法后,如果仍然遇到掛載權限不足的問題,請提供更多詳細信息,以便我能為你提供更具體的解決方案。